public async Task <CountyCreateResultDto> Post(CountyCreateDto countyCreateDto) { var modelCounty = _iMapper.Map <CountyModel>(countyCreateDto); var entityCounty = _iMapper.Map <CountyEntity>(modelCounty); var resultCounty = await _countyRepository.InsertAsync(entityCounty); return(_iMapper.Map <CountyCreateResultDto>(resultCounty)); }
public CountyTest() { IdCounty = Guid.NewGuid(); NameCounty = Faker.Address.StreetName(); CodeIbgeCounty = Faker.RandomNumber.Next(1, 10000); NameUpdate = Faker.Address.StreetName(); CodeIbgeUpdate = Faker.RandomNumber.Next(1, 10000); FederalUnitId = Guid.NewGuid(); for (int i = 0; i < 10; i++) { var dto = new CountyDto() { Id = Guid.NewGuid(), Name = Faker.Name.FullName(), CodeIbge = Faker.RandomNumber.Next(1, 10000), FederalUnitId = Guid.NewGuid() }; listCountyDto.Add(dto); } countyDto = new CountyDto { Id = IdCounty, Name = NameCounty, CodeIbge = CodeIbgeCounty, FederalUnitId = FederalUnitId }; countyCompleteDto = new CountyCompleteDto { Id = IdCounty, Name = NameCounty, CodeIbge = CodeIbgeCounty, FederalUnitId = FederalUnitId, FederalUnit = new FederalUnitDto { Id = Guid.NewGuid(), Name = Faker.Address.UsState(), Initials = Faker.Address.UsState().Substring(1, 3) } }; countyCreateDto = new CountyCreateDto { Name = NameCounty, CodeIbge = CodeIbgeCounty, FederalUnitId = FederalUnitId }; countyCreateResultDto = new CountyCreateResultDto { Id = IdCounty, Name = NameCounty, CodeIbge = CodeIbgeCounty, FederalUnitId = FederalUnitId, CreateAt = DateTime.Now }; countyUpdateDto = new CountyUpdateDto { Id = IdCounty, Name = NameUpdate, CodeIbge = CodeIbgeUpdate, FederalUnitId = FederalUnitId }; countyUpdateResultDto = new CountyUpdateResultDto { Id = IdCounty, Name = NameUpdate, CodeIbge = CodeIbgeUpdate, FederalUnitId = FederalUnitId, UpdateAt = DateTime.Now }; }